What is power performance testing?
Testing performance is essential to ensuring that turbine and plant performance meet expectations and contractual obligations. Put simply, power performance testing is measuring wind speed, measuring a turbine’s power output, then plotting the power versus wind speed and comparing that to the warranted power curve.
Should a met tower be closer to a turbine?
Placing a met tower closer to a wind turbine can exaggerate the 'blockage effect' on the power curve test. This method of scatter reduction is a trade-off, so the pros and cons must be weighed carefully.

What is a meteorological tower?
A meteorological tower (met tower) is a structure used in the wind industry to gather wind-speed measurements. It is configured with industry-standard anemometers. Meteorological towers have been used for decades for wind energy measurement applications to technically support project financings.
